What I feel is science (including psychology) observes and analyzes human experience from the outside using data
Here is why I think that's subtly incorrect. Science also explores things like beliefs, and what kind of beliefs increase which kind of outcome in a probabilistic and statistical manner. It also maps stimulating neurons by injecting neurotransmitters or electrically to evoke specific things in people. This is direct causal manipulation.
Hope you can see that this simplistic subject-object framing breaks down for such things. Science is more complicated and nuanced than you seem to think.
For example, saying the mind is a separate entity that cannot be investigated is like saying the Operating System of my Android OS is also like that. The phone is the hardware, the software OS is cosmic and ephemeral.
I hope you can see that this is not true. The same correlations and causality have already been demonstrated by biology, neuroscience and other domains of science when it comes to human perception and subjective experiences.
